betaxed

/bɪˈtækst/
adjective
  1. Heavily burdened or stressed, especially by demands, responsibilities, or taxes.
    • The betaxed citizens complained about the new government fees.
    • The small business owner was betaxed by both high rent and rising costs.
    • She felt betaxed by the endless requests from her family and coworkers.
